Brooklyn’s Rising Streetwear Brand, Brigade, Unveils Spring ’24 Lookbook

Brooklyn-based streetwear brand Brigade has just released the lookbook for its highly anticipated Spring ’24 collection.

Established in 2014, Brigade has undergone a remarkable evolution over the past decade, transcending the initial “streetwear startup” phase characterized by basic graphic tees and hoodies. Instead, the brand has delved into the realm of technically advanced garments, exemplified by pieces like the Zion Jacket. Constructed from waxed cotton for enhanced durability and water resistance, the Zion Jacket utilizes beeswax-derived materials, prioritizing environmental sustainability over conventional plastics typically used in similar outerwear.

“Our focus this season was on elevating staple garments into attention-grabbing pieces,” explains Brigade. “This collection embodies a reimagination of classic silhouettes, such as the Zion Jacket and Split Knee Cargo Pants, transforming them into meticulously detailed and technically proficient apparel.”

A standout piece in this collection is the Moto Knit Jacket, which reinterprets the iconic leather motorcycle jacket as a knitted masterpiece, incorporating three distinct knit patterns in its design. The Split Knee Cargo Pants offer a relaxed, baggy fit and are crafted from mid-weight ripstop cotton. Founder and designer Aaron Maldonado pays tribute to his Dominican and Puerto Rican heritage with knit sweaters featuring the flags of both countries prominently displayed on the chest.
